.NET 10 Becomes Available on AWS Lambda as Managed Runtime and Base Image
"Amazon Web Services has announced that AWS Lambda now supports creating serverless applications using .NET 10. With this update, developers can use .NET 10 both as a managed runtime and as a container-based image when building and running Lambda functions. AWS stated that updates to the managed runtime and base images will be applied automatically as new versions become available, reducing the need for manual maintenance by development teams."
".NET 10 is the latest long-term support release of the .NET platform and is expected to receive security updates and bug fixes until November 2028. By making .NET 10 available on AWS Lambda, AWS is giving developers access to the latest platform features in a serverless environment. This includes support for file-based applications, which are designed to simplify application structure and development workflows."
"In addition, Powertools for AWS Lambda (.NET), a toolkit designed to help developers follow serverless best practices and improve development speed, now supports .NET 10. Developers can continue to use a wide range of AWS tools to deploy and manage their applications, including the Lambda console, AWS Command Line Interface, AWS Serverless Application Model, AWS Cloud Development Kit, and AWS CloudFormation."
